Bathrooms nowadays are a lot more than functional spaces, they are a way to make your mark on a property and give yourself a piece of luxury every day. Besides the actual hard finishes and sanitary-ware choices that you can have another way to make your mark is with the use of indoor plants. Plants provide more than aesthetics though. Studies haven been done that show indoor plants can improve the air quality in your home. In addition plants can help contribute to reducing stress which can go a long way into making your bathroom feel like more of a high end spa. You can't just put any plant in your bathroom, you need one which will thrive. Bathrooms are typically humid and warm places at certain times, during and after showers for example. Remodeling your bathrooms can be quite expensive, on the average is costs about €7,500 for a remodeling project. For most people, that is a hefty financial commitment. There are cost cutting measures you can implement to help undertake that remodeling project without having to break the bank. Save On Your Tiles The cost of tiles is one of the highest in a remodeling project, if you decide to tile the floor and wall the cost might just be too much. To save cost, tile only the essential places like the floor. You can paint the wall and the shower stalls in a color shade like the tile color. Manage Your Counter Tops Granite counter tops have become a common sight in many bathrooms recently, to save on your bathroom counter tops buy colors that not common. Can a bathroom vent into the attic? Modern bathrooms can come in all shapes and sizes and with lots of fancy extras. That luxury power shower that you wanted gives a great start to your day. But have you given a thought to all of the steam that it will generate? One thing that needs to be considered is the waste air from the bathroom. This is typically moist and can be warm. The perfect combination for mould growth. Because of this you need to ensure that whatever you do to vent your bathroom is properly thought through. Some people think that they can simply vent their bathroom into the attic after all out of sight out of mind right? Who goes up there much anyway. Wrong!
